NCP Chairman Dahal postpones his China trip



KATHMANDU: Chairman of the ruling Nepal Communist Party (NCP) Pushpa Kamal Dahal has postponed his China visit owing to what has been said ‘deteriorating’ health condition of Prime Minister K P Oli, a party leader said.

Dahal was scheduled to embark on a China visit leading a 60-member jumbo team of the party on December 10 at the invitation by the Communist Party of China (CPC).

According to NCP leader Agni Sapkota, Chairman Dahal has postponed his China visit considering the health of PM Oli, who is currently in hospital.

Meanwhile, Prime Minister Oli today had earlier explained to the people about his health condition saying he is recuperating and is in good spirits.

Prime Minister Oli in a video message on Twitter from the hospital bed said he has been ‘able to talk and watch news’.
